Offshore Casino Hits Coral Reef, 'Sinks'

Puerto Vallarta, Mexico - Barrio Del Mar offshore casino and sportsbook ran into a coral reef off Baja California Sunday and sank in 14 feet of water. All three crew members and all seven bookies survived and seemed in remarkably good spirits.The former Central American tuna trawler had been an offshore gaming facility for over seven months now and because of that longevity was considered the granddaddy of west coast offshore sportsbooks. Barrio Del Mar chief operations officer Vig Vicarelli said the ship experienced a “sudden leak or somethin’, or maybe it was a storm, I think that was it,” and insisted it had nothing to do with their “Syracuse Won’t Make The Final Four In A Billion Years!” promotional wager. Vicarelli apologized to his clientele and said, “You’re winnings are down there, you just gotta go get ‘em. Be careful, there’s a bastard of a rip curl. Sharks, too.”
